Hydrostatic Pressure Water Removal Cost In Columbiana, OH
The cost of hydrostatic pressure water removal varies based on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Columbiana, OH. These are estimates, not guarantees. Call us today to schedule a free estimate and get a more accurate quote.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water removal and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Contamination cleanup | $200 – $1,000 | Severity of contamination, size of affected area, and local conditions |
| Dehumidification and air movers |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Structural drying | $1,000 – $5,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ions |
| Containment and extraction |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Disinfection and sanitizing | $200 – $1,000 | Severity of contamination, size of affected area, and local conditions |
